Reporting to the Manager of Library Services, The Librarian is responsible for the development and maintenance of the Library's collection. This position determines procedures for Library technical services and recommends improvements to public services, programs, and policies, and ensures professional standards are met to provide the highest quality of service as mandated. As responsibilities are carried out across multiple community facilities, access to a reliable vehicle and the ability to travel between locations is required.
Duties & Responsibilities:
- Advises and assists Library users in the selection of and access to information services, electronic resources and collections.
- Provides directives and training to front-line staff on corresponding areas of responsibility such as reader’s advisory, accessing electronic resources and collection management.
- Evaluates, selects and deselects materials within the Library’s primary adult information and leisure reading collections.
- Purchases and monitors the budget for collections relating to area of responsibility. Coordinates materials purchases from the Library’s vendors.
- Advises the Assistant Librarians on the implementation of processing requirements.
- Acts as intermediary higher authority with respect to information service and collections related complaints.
- Liaises with other libraries and members of the profession to keep abreast of trends, techniques, and standards of public library information services.
- Provides direct service to the public with service desk assignments.
- Takes responsibility for personal safety and health in the workplace and the safety and health of co-workers.
- Must work in compliance with the law and safe work practices and guidelines.
Key Qualifications:
- M.L.S. from an accredited university.
- One-year public library experience and experience working with the public.
- Valid G Driver’s License.
- Computer, software, and internet knowledge.
- Demonstrated ability to work with children.
- Strong public speaking skills with an ability to conduct classes and speak in front of program groups, including children and adults.
- Knowledge of Library Policies/Procedures, copyright legislation.
- Excellent verbal communication skills.
- Excellent interpersonal skills and the ability to build beneficial relationships.
- Teamwork and cooperation.
- Proven ability to multi-task and work accurately in a busy environment.
This is a full-time, unionized position working 35 hours per week. The wage rate is $31.57 per hour and comes with a comprehensive compensation package including benefits and OMERS Pension Plan.
